Mesothelioma Attorneys
A mesothelioma lawyer can help families and victims receive compensation from the asbestos trust fund. Billions of dollars have been set aside by companies responsible for the production of asbestos-containing products.
Attorneys can aid victims throughout the legal process, from identifying potential exposure sites to filing a lawsuit. A national firm will be able to know the statutes of limitations in each state and ensure that clients don't miss their deadlines.
Free case evaluations
A free assessment of your case is your chance to meet with a lawyer from a top mesothelioma law firm to discuss the specifics of your exposure. The evaluation will help determine whether you're a candidate for a case and the amount of compensation you could receive. It will also provide an attorney with an understanding of your exposure and how mesothelioma symptoms affect you.
Legal help for mesothelioma can be vital to surviving the aggressive cancer. Asbestos patients often end up with high medical expenses and a short life expectancy. Compensation for mesothelioma patients is an excellent way to pay for treatment. Compensation may pay for lost wages, travel expenses for treatments, or family support.
Based on the type of mesothelioma found, the victim can seek compensation through personal injury or wrongful death lawsuits. These lawsuits can be brought against asbestos companies that caused the victim's exposure. In the past mesothelioma patients could file class-action suits. However, these types of lawsuits are not as popular today as they usually offer victims a lower amount of compensation.
A mesothelioma litigation attorney can also assist veterans to file VA benefits for mesothelioma. Compensation from the VA may be used to pay for mesothelioma treatment, caregiver costs or other costs. A mesothelioma legal team can also review medical records and study asbestos trust funds to determine the most appropriate financial assistance.

Highly valuable advice
A mesothelioma lawyer can provide valuable advice to help asbestos sufferers make informed choices regarding their legal options. When you receive a no-cost case evaluation An experienced attorney will review your medical records and outline your options for compensation. A mesothelioma attorney will also guide you on how to file various kinds of claims. For instance the personal injury claim could seek compensation for your future and current medical expenses. A wrongful death lawsuit can be filed to seek compensation for the estate and family of a loved ones. Mesothelioma lawyers can also aid in filing asbestos trust fund claims to obtain financial relief.
Asbestos lawyers can assist you in filing an action against negligent asbestos manufacturers responsible for your exposure. These cases can be complex and require an experienced attorney who is familiar with the asbestos laws of the state and regulations. In most states the statute of limitations is a period of time that must be met in order to complete mesothelioma lawsuits. A mesothelioma lawyer can ensure that your claim is filed within the deadline and is handled properly.
The best mesothelioma case lawyers will be on a contingent basis. This arrangement will take care of your needs and ensures that you receive the highest amount of compensation that is possible.
Many asbestos-related companies have gone under, and some have established bankruptcy trusts to pay victims of asbestos-related diseases. A mesothelioma attorney with experience will know how to utilize trust funds to get the amount you are entitled to. They will also prepare the necessary paperwork and submit them to the appropriate trustees. They will ensure that your bankruptcy claim is processed quickly. They will also fight for fair and appropriate compensation so that you and your family can receive the medical care you require.
